In 30 seconds
- What happened
- LangChain released Tuned Evaluators for LangSmith, starting with Perceived Error detection that flags agent mistakes in production conversations automatically.
- Why it matters
- Teams running conversational agents in production need continuous quality monitoring without manually sampling traces or managing expensive frontier model evaluations.
- Watch out
- Perceived Error evaluator requires threads with at least two human-AI message pairs and evaluates within 12 hours; currently available only in US on Plus and Enterprise plans.
